PHP Class JiraRestApi\Issue\TimeTracking

Inheritance: implements JsonSerializable, use trait JiraRestApi\ClassSerialize
Datei anzeigen Open project: lesstif/php-jira-rest-client Class Usage Examples

Public Properties

Property Type Description
$originalEstimate Original estimate.
$originalEstimateSeconds integer Original estimate in seconds, generated in jira for create/update issue set $this->originalEstimate.
$remainingEstimate Remaining estimate.
$remainingEstimateSeconds integer Remaining estimate in seconds, generated in jira for create/update issue set $this->remainingEstimate.
$timeSpent Time spent.
$timeSpentSeconds integer Time spent in seconds, generated in jira for create/update issue set $this->timeSpent.

Public Methods

Method Description
getOriginalEstimate ( ) : string
getOriginalEstimateSeconds ( ) : integer
getRemainingEstimate ( ) : string
getRemainingEstimateSeconds ( ) : integer
getTimeSpent ( ) : string
getTimeSpentSeconds ( ) : integer
jsonSerialize ( ) : mixed (PHP 5 >= 5.4.0)
Specify data which should be serialized to JSON.
setOriginalEstimate ( string $originalEstimate )
setOriginalEstimateSeconds ( integer $originalEstimateSeconds )
setRemainingEstimate ( string $remainingEstimate )
setRemainingEstimateSeconds ( integer $remainingEstimateSeconds )
setTimeSpent ( string $timeSpent )
setTimeSpentSeconds ( integer $timeSpentSeconds )

Method Details

getOriginalEstimate() public method

public getOriginalEstimate ( ) : string
return string

getOriginalEstimateSeconds() public method

getRemainingEstimate() public method

public getRemainingEstimate ( ) : string
return string

getRemainingEstimateSeconds() public method

getTimeSpent() public method

public getTimeSpent ( ) : string
return string

getTimeSpentSeconds() public method

public getTimeSpentSeconds ( ) : integer
return integer

jsonSerialize() public method

(PHP 5 >= 5.4.0)
Specify data which should be serialized to JSON.
public jsonSerialize ( ) : mixed
return mixed data which can be serialized by json_encode, which is a value of any type other than a resource.

setOriginalEstimate() public method

public setOriginalEstimate ( string $originalEstimate )
$originalEstimate string

setOriginalEstimateSeconds() public method

public setOriginalEstimateSeconds ( integer $originalEstimateSeconds )
$originalEstimateSeconds integer

setRemainingEstimate() public method

public setRemainingEstimate ( string $remainingEstimate )
$remainingEstimate string

setRemainingEstimateSeconds() public method

public setRemainingEstimateSeconds ( integer $remainingEstimateSeconds )
$remainingEstimateSeconds integer

setTimeSpent() public method

public setTimeSpent ( string $timeSpent )
$timeSpent string

setTimeSpentSeconds() public method

public setTimeSpentSeconds ( integer $timeSpentSeconds )
$timeSpentSeconds integer

Property Details

$originalEstimate public_oe property

Original estimate.
public $originalEstimate

$originalEstimateSeconds public_oe property

Original estimate in seconds, generated in jira for create/update issue set $this->originalEstimate.
public int $originalEstimateSeconds
return integer

$remainingEstimate public_oe property

Remaining estimate.
public $remainingEstimate

$remainingEstimateSeconds public_oe property

Remaining estimate in seconds, generated in jira for create/update issue set $this->remainingEstimate.
public int $remainingEstimateSeconds
return integer

$timeSpent public_oe property

Time spent.
public $timeSpent

$timeSpentSeconds public_oe property

Time spent in seconds, generated in jira for create/update issue set $this->timeSpent.
public int $timeSpentSeconds
return integer